Prerequisites
-------------
Note that the application stack should not necessarily be running when applying any of the instructions below, unless explicitly stated otherwise. For instance, suppose the stack has been down for quite some time or have never even been up yet -- rather than starting it beforehand use a single ``$ docker-compose -f local.yml run --rm <command>`` with the desired command. By contrast, should you already have your application up and running do not bother waiting for ``run`` instruction to finish (they usually take a bit longer due to bootstrapping phase), just use ``$ docker-compose -f local.yml exec <command>`` instead; note that any ``exec`` command fails unless all of the required containers are running. From now on, we will be using ``run``-style examples for general-case compatibility.
